Uploaded image for project: 'OpenOLAT'
  1. OpenOLAT
  2. OO-3055

Document library based on Taxonomy/Competency

    XMLWordPrintable

    Details

    • Funded by:

      Description

      In setups where study fields are organized using a taxonomy structure it is common to have documents related to those study fields that are organized using the exact same taxonomy structure. As of OpenOLAT 12.2 it is possible to create such a taxonomy catalog and thus it is also possible to dynamically create a virtual filesystem that mimics the structure of the taxonomy. 

      In addition, when users are related to the taxonomy structure using competences, we can use this knowledge to implement access control to the virtual file system. 

      The goal of this issue is to implement such an automated document library / management system based on taxonomy structure and competences. 

      See mockups

       

      Features

      • Configuration in taxonomy admin to enable the document library and to configure the access rights for each taxonomy level type based on competency types
      • New site to access the document library in Web UI
      • WebDAV handler to access the document library via WebDAV
      • Support for fulltext indexer and search
      • Support for notification when new files are added to the library
      • Support for a single special purpose folder on root level that is visible regardless of the competency based access rights
      • Customization of start page using the HTML editor (like a single page)

      frentix intern: CL-671 

       

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              srosse Stéphane Rossé
              Reporter:
              gnaegi Florian Gnägi
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 2 days, 6 hours, 34 minutes
                  2d 6h 34m